Tri 1 side/2 angles Constructions Example 1: To construct a triangle of base 9 cm with angles of 35 o and 65 o. To construct a triangle, given 1 side and 2 angles. 1. Draw a straight line 9 cm long. A B 9 cm 3. Draw straight lines from A and B to point of intersection to form the triangle. 2. Use a protractor to draw angles of 35 o and 65 o on either end of line.

Constructions Example 1: To construct a triangle of sides 8 cm, 7cm and 6 cm. 1. Draw line 8cm long and use as base of triangle. A B 8 cm 2. Set compass to 7 cm, place at A and draw an arc. 7 cm 6 cm 4. Draw straight lines from A and B to point of intersection. 3. Set compass to 6 cm, place at B and draw an arc to intersect the first one..
Constructions Example 2: To construct a triangle of sides 7 cm, 9 cm and 4 cm. 1. Using the longest side as the base, draw a straight line 9 cm long. A B 9 cm 2. Set compass to 7 cm, place at A and draw an arc. 4. Draw straight lines from A and B to point of intersection. 3. Set compass to 4 cm, place at B and draw an arc to intersect the first one. 7 cm 4 cm.
